Man United Revive Interest in €60m Rated Spanish Defender, Bookmarked as One of the Prime Targets This Summer

Pau Torres, Manchester United

According to latest reports, Manchester United have revived their interest in Villarreal defender Pau Torres. The Red Devils are looking to bring in a new centre-back in the upcoming transfer window and have shortlisted the 25-year-old as one of the prime candidates.

United are certainly out of the top-four race, but are still in contention for a Europa League spot. However, the Rangnick’s men face the threat of finishing in a Europa Conference League spot if they fail to win their last Premier League game of the season against Crystal Palace.

With Erik ten Hag set to take over the reins starting this week, Man United are preparing for a major squad overhaul in the summer to help him rebuild a  challenging squad. As many as 12 players are set to leave Old Trafford including central defenders Phil Jones and Eric Bailly.

According to Fabrizio Romano (via The Sun), Manchester United have shortlisted 3-4 defenders as potential centre-back signings and Pau Torres has been bookmarked as one of them. However, they haven’t tabled an offer yet as they are waiting for the Dutch manager to take up his position at Old Trafford before going ahead with the deal.

The Red Devils have been closely following the Spanish defenders for some time now. Last summer, Pau Torres was heavily linked with a move to Manchester United, but the board opted to sign Real Madrid defender Raphael Varane instead.

Manchester Evening News reported last month that United have reignited their interest in the Villarreal centre-half, given defensive reinforcements are crucial for the Manchester club. Pau Torres has been one of the most consistent defenders across Europe this season, dropping regular stellar performances at the back with veteran Raul Albiol.

One of the 25-year-old’s biggest achievements this season has been keeping Bayern Munich from scoring even a single goal at home in this year’s UCL quarter-final and conceding just one at the Allianz Arena. The Spaniard has enjoyed a successful season at Villarreal so far after making it to the Champions League semifinals in a real underdog story. The La Liga club also knocked out Juventus in the Round of 16.

Torres hasn’t just attracted interest from one English club. Last season Tottenham Hotspur had a €60 million bid accepted by Villarreal for the Spaniard, but the player rejected the move. The allure of playing in the Champions League fuelled the defender to reject a move to a club where his wages could have been quadrupled.

United could face a similar issue since the club has failed to finish in a Champions League spot, a major point of appeal for many players across the globe. However, Man United would be eager to look for defensive replacements, with Raphael Varane struggling at Old Trafford and Harry Maguire becoming the butt of heavy ridicule and criticism in the past few months.

According to MEN, the Spaniard would be open to a move away but is in “no rush” to leave his boyhood club, where he has spent his entire club career. It is understood that Torres’ current deal with the Yellow Submarine, signed until 2024, features a release clause around the 60 million euros.

Nevertheless, United faces stiff competition from Premier League rivals, Chelsea, who are also interested in the Spaniard. In the same sense, Chelsea too are waiting for the Todd Boehly takeover before making any concrete attempts or moves for the player.
